哪些故障破坏数据库数据
-
-
存储介质故障:例如硬盘故障、存储阵列故障等,可能导致数据库文件损坏或丢失。
-
数据库软件故障:数据库软件本身出现问题,比如关键文件损坏、配置错误等,可能导致数据库无法正常启动或运行,进而造成数据损坏。
-
人为操作失误:误操作或者误删除数据库中的重要数据,例如错误的SQL语句执行导致数据被误删除。
-
病毒或恶意软件:恶意软件可能会破坏数据库文件或者利用漏洞进行攻击,导致数据丢失或被篡改。
-
硬件故障:服务器硬件故障,如CPU故障、内存故障等,可能导致数据库的数据不一致性或丢失。
1年前 -
-
故障是任何数据库管理员和数据专业人员都必须面对的挑战,它可能会对数据库中的数据造成严重破坏。以下是一些可能导致数据库数据破坏的常见故障:
-
硬件故障:硬件故障可能导致数据丢失或损坏。例如,硬盘故障可能导致数据丢失,内存故障可能导致正在处理的数据受损。网络故障也可能导致数据包丢失或损坏。
-
软件故障:操作系统或数据库管理系统本身的软件错误可能会导致数据丢失或损坏。例如,操作系统崩溃可能导致正在写入的数据丢失,数据库软件错误可能导致数据在存储或检索时出现错误。
-
人为错误:人为错误可能是最常见也是最不可预测的故障之一。误操作、误删除、错误的配置或设置都可能导致数据破坏。
-
恶意攻击:恶意软件、黑客攻击、数据泄露等网络安全问题可能导致数据被篡改、删除或泄露。
-
自然灾害:火灾、洪水、地震等自然灾害可能导致数据库服务器和存储设备受损,从而导致数据灾难性丢失。
-
电源故障:电力波动、断电或供电中断可能导致正在写入的数据丢失或数据库损坏。
-
存储介质故障:硬盘、固态硬盘或存储设备的损坏可能导致数据丢失,无法读取或写入数据。
总的来说,数据库数据破坏的原因包括硬件故障、软件故障、人为错误、恶意攻击、自然灾害和电源故障等多种因素。针对这些故障,数据库管理员需要采取相应的措施来保护数据库的安全性和完整性。
1年前 -
-
故障可能以各种形式影响数据库系统的稳定性,导致数据丢失或损坏。以下是一些可能导致数据库数据破坏的常见故障:
1. 人为错误
- 误删除数据:操作人员误删数据库中的重要数据。
- 错误更新:更新操作错误,导致数据不一致或丢失。
- 错误插入:插入数据错误,可能导致数据不符合要求。
2. 硬件故障
- 磁盘故障:硬盘损坏可能导致数据无法读取或写入,从而破坏数据完整性。
- 内存故障:内存出现问题可能导致运行时数据丢失或损坏。
- CPU故障:CPU故障可能导致数据库系统运行不稳定或数据操作失败。
3. 软件故障
- 数据库软件故障:数据库软件本身的bug或问题可能导致数据操作异常。
- 操作系统故障:操作系统故障可能导致数据库系统无法正常运行,影响数据的稳定性。
- 网络故障:网络故障可能导致数据传输失败或不完整,导致数据破坏。
4. 自然灾害
- 火灾:火灾可能导致服务器硬件损坏,导致数据库数据无法访问。
- 水灾:水灾可能导致服务器受潮,导致数据库数据丢失或损坏。
- 地震:地震可能导致服务器设备摔落或故障,影响数据库数据的完整性。
5. 安全攻击
- 病毒攻击:病毒可能感染数据库系统,导致数据被篡改或删除。
- 黑客攻击:黑客可能通过网络攻击手段入侵数据库系统,窃取数据或破坏数据。
6. 电源故障
- 停电:突然停电可能导致数据库系统无法正常关闭,造成数据损坏。
- 电压不稳:电压不稳定可能导致设备故障,影响数据库的稳定性。
7. 数据库配置错误
- 参数设置不当:数据库参数设置错误可能导致系统运行异常,影响数据的完整性。
- 备份策略不合理:不合理的备份策略可能导致数据备份不全或无法恢复。
综上所述,数据库数据可能因各种因素而破坏,因此数据库管理员应该采取相应的措施来防范和应对各种潜在的风险。
1年前


